<?php
namespace Codeception\Util;

class ArrayContainsComparatorTest extends \Codeception\Test\Unit
{
    /**
     * @var ArrayContainsComparator
     */
    protected $ary;

    protected function _before()
    {
        $this->ary = new ArrayContainsComparator(
            [
                'ticket' => [
                    'title'  => 'Bug should be fixed',
                    'user'   => ['name' => 'Davert'],
                    'labels' => null
                ]
            ]
        );
    }

    // tests
    public function testInclusion()
    {
        $this->assertTrue($this->ary->containsArray(['name' => 'Davert']));
        $this->assertTrue($this->ary->containsArray(['user' => ['name' => 'Davert']]));
        $this->assertTrue($this->ary->containsArray(['ticket' => ['title' => 'Bug should be fixed']]));
        $this->assertTrue($this->ary->containsArray(['ticket' => ['user' => ['name' => 'Davert']]]));
        $this->assertTrue($this->ary->containsArray(['ticket' => ['labels' => null]]));
    }

    /**
     * @Issue https://github.com/Codeception/Codeception/issues/2070
     */
    public function testContainsArrayComparesArrayWithMultipleZeroesCorrectly()
    {
        $comparator = new ArrayContainsComparator([
            'responseCode' => 0,
            'message' => 'OK',
            'data' => [9, 0, 0],
        ]);

        $expectedArray = [
            'responseCode' => 0,
            'message' => 'OK',
            'data' => [0, 0, 0],
        ];

        $this->assertFalse($comparator->containsArray($expectedArray));
    }

    public function testContainsArrayComparesArrayWithMultipleIdenticalSubArraysCorrectly()
    {
        $comparator = new ArrayContainsComparator([
            'responseCode' => 0,
            'message' => 'OK',
            'data' => [[9], [0], [0]],
        ]);

        $expectedArray = [
            'responseCode' => 0,
            'message' => 'OK',
            'data' => [[0], [0], [0]],
        ];

        $this->assertFalse($comparator->containsArray($expectedArray));
    }

    public function testContainsArrayComparesArrayWithValueRepeatedMultipleTimesCorrectlyNegativeCase()
    {
        $comparator = new ArrayContainsComparator(['foo', 'foo', 'bar']);
        $expectedArray = ['foo', 'foo', 'foo'];
        $this->assertFalse($comparator->containsArray($expectedArray));
    }

    public function testContainsArrayComparesArrayWithValueRepeatedMultipleTimesCorrectlyPositiveCase()
    {
        $comparator = new ArrayContainsComparator(['foo', 'foo', 'bar']);
        $expectedArray = ['foo', 'bar', 'foo'];
        $this->assertTrue($comparator->containsArray($expectedArray));
    }
